What do the fellow canadian members think about this whole situation? For those who don't know.... AdScam is basically refering to millions of dollars that the current Liberal Government in Canada has flitered money out of the treasury and into private firms, and then got donations back from these firms in exchange for contracts.... anyway.... most people in Canada are awaiting an election in the coming weeks/months... and the last poll I saw put Conservatives in the lead with about 38% support... liberals at 25% NDP at 20% and bloc around 15 not 100% positive on those numbers but still.... Canada has been screwed over by this liberal government and it's time for a change.... |
